SAS 编程需要使用什么样的开发环境?其实,跟任何恰计算机语言一样,你可以用任何纯文本编辑器编写 SAS 代码,比如 Windows 平台的记事本,NotePad++,你也可以使用 Unix 上的vi 来编辑代码。不过需要注意的是,Windows 上使用回车换行 CRLF而 Unix&n
在现代数据工作流中,有时候我们需要将 Python 与 SAS 相结合,以便利用两者各自的优势。尤其是在数据分析、统计和报表生成等方面,Python 的灵活性与 SAS 的强大功能结合起来,可以极大提高工作效率。然而,这个过程也并非轻松,尤其是涉及到参数配置、调试、性能优化等步骤。本文将详细阐述使用 Python 运行 SAS 的整个过程。
## 背景定位
在业务领域,能够快速准确地分析数据至
翻译:张玲校对:吴金笛本文约
3000字,建议阅读5分钟。 关于三种数据科学工具Python、R和SAS,本文从8个角度进行比较分析并在文末提供记分卡,以便你随时调整权重,快速做出选择。简介我们喜欢比较!从比较三星、苹果、HTC的智能手机,iOS、Android、Windows的移动操作系统到比较即将选举的选举候选人,或者选择世界杯队长,比较和讨论丰富了我们的生活。如果你
转载
2024-01-31 17:40:09
63阅读
项目背景公司内部的软件采用B/S架构,目的是进行实验室的数据存储、分析、管理。大部分是数据的增删改查,但是由于还在开发阶段,所以UI的变化非常快,难以针对UI进行自动化测试,那样会消耗大量的精力与时间维护自动化脚本,对于小团队来说就得不偿失了。针对此种情况,选用接口测试较为有效。工具选择针对接口测试的自动化工具也很多,例如Soup UI、Postman、robotframework,甚至jmete
记录《Python数据分析实战》一书中关于意大利北部沿海地区气象数据分析的练习。此次分析的目的是验证靠海对气候的影响,因此,选取10个城市分析他们的天气数据,其中5个城市距离海100公里以内,另外5个城市距离海100~400公里距离。此外,为了避免山区气候对天气数据造成影响,选取的城市均来自平原地区。 1. 加载数据集# 导入模块
import numpy as np
i
转载
2023-08-13 22:42:37
117阅读
# 从 Python 调用和运行 SAS 脚本的完整指南
作为一名新手开发者,如果你希望使用 Python 来调用和执行 SAS 脚本,那么你来对地方了。本文将详细介绍这个流程,并提供你需要的代码示例和解释。在开始之前,我们可以先了解一下整个流程。
## 流程概览
| 步骤 | 描述 |
|------|------------------------|
相信了解SAS软件的朋友都知道,SAS主要由DATA步和PROC步组成,其中DATA步作为数据读入、清洗、整理的主要程序步,学好DATA就显得尤为重要。而了解DATA步,重中之重就得了解PDV(LogicalProgram Data Vector)。首先DATA步的处理分为两个阶段:◇编译◇执行编译由此可知,PDV在DATA步的编译阶段就已存在,那在DATA步的编译阶段究竟发生了什么事呢?1检查D
转载
2023-10-16 09:26:32
264阅读
SAS数据挖掘实战篇【二】
从
SAS数据挖掘实战篇【一】介绍完目前的数据挖掘基本概念之外,对整个
数据挖掘的概念和应用有初步的认识和宏观的把握之后,我们来了解一下SAS数据挖掘实战篇【二】SAS工具的应用。首先来看一下SAS大概的一个软件界面。(这里面实际操作性较强,建议都打开软件,step by step自己操作一遍,印象深刻)操作流程如下:
金融经济 | Stata在毕业论文中的数据处理应用利益相关:我们是英国文文校园,一群热心的学姐学长帮你解答有关英国留学学习生活的疑难杂症!!这个问题邀请了谢菲尔德经济博士Bo马住回答!Tips & 心得感悟体会 Stata作为款简易上手的数据处理软件,在我Master dissertation和我的PhD学术论文创作中都起着非常重要的作用。配合Stata的help指令可以查看指令的详细说明
转载
2023-09-02 23:26:21
62阅读
最近团队在做代码移植,将C++代码用scala实现服务端的矩阵算法,做到最后一步发现C++的文件压缩是直接调用python脚本来实现的,本着一致性的原则,文件压缩也用scala来实现。但是测试的时候发现,这个压缩效率跟调用python执行相差太大了,2G的txt格式文件,用scala实现压缩用了将近200秒,但是用python只需要大约40秒,有点接受不了
转载
2023-12-15 09:56:15
103阅读
pandas是一个Python语言的软件包,在我们使用Python语言进行机器学习编程的时候,这是一个非常常用的基础编程库。本文是对它的一个入门教程。pandas提供了快速,灵活和富有表现力的数据结构,目的是使“关系”或“标记”数据的工作既简单又直观。它旨在成为在Python中进行实际数据分析的高级构建块。入门介绍pandas适合于许多不同类型的数据,包括:具有异构类型列的表格数据,例如SQL表格
转载
2023-09-16 13:49:33
306阅读
# SAS与Python的结合:数据分析的新选择
在数据科学的领域,SAS(Statistical Analysis System)和Python是两种广泛使用的工具。它们各自具有不同的优势,但在许多情况下,结合这两者的力量,可以极大地增强数据分析的能力。本文将从这两个工具的基本概念入手,探讨它们的特点及其结合使用的场景,最后给出简单的代码示例来展示这一结合的使用方法。
## 什么是SAS?
# SAS的代码跟Python相似吗?
## 一、整体流程
我们首先要明确整个教学过程的步骤,可以用以下表格展示:
| 步骤 | 内容 |
| --- | --- |
| 1 | 了解SAS和Python的基本语法和特点 |
| 2 | 比较SAS和Python的语法和功能差异 |
| 3 | 实际操作SAS和Python代码进行对比 |
| 4 | 总结经验和建议 |
## 二、详细步骤
原创
2024-06-01 05:44:14
71阅读
关于python和SAS的一点看法写在前面的最近一直没更随笔,是因为参加了个SAS大赛,准备了几天也没时间更新随笔。 比赛的总体效果不理想,目前看晋级决赛的希望不大。主要原因是考试内容多为编程相关,作为 学统计出身的一开始就把重点放在了统计方法的选择与应用场景上,目前的我的编程能力还处在初级阶段 希望明年能够有所提升那么我一开始就是SAS与python同步开始的那么这两个
转载
2023-06-21 16:40:54
212阅读
一、Scrapy介绍 Scrapy是一个为了爬取网站数据,提取结构性数据而编写的应用框架,我们只需要实现少量的代码,就能够快速的抓取。 这是因为 Scrapy 使用了 Twisted['twɪstɪd]异步网络框架,可以加快我们的下载速度。异步:调用在发出之后,这个调用就直接返回,不管有无结果非阻塞:关注的是程序在等待调用结果(消息,返回值)时的状态,指在不能立刻得到结果之前,该调用不会阻塞当前线
转载
2024-02-05 20:31:46
33阅读
SAS统计分析软件属于一款大型软件,某软件下载网站显示为26GB,下载和安装均较为困难。那么,是否有在线版本可以使用?答案是肯定的,SAS官方提供了一个在线使用SAS软件的网站。 网址:https://odamid.oda.sas.com一、 注册SAS官网帐户使用SAS在线软件,首先需要注册一个SAS官网帐户,注册需要使用邮箱,但要注意的是并不支持qq邮箱,可以使用163等邮箱。SAS官网(ht
转载
2024-01-10 21:24:35
246阅读
## Python读取SAS文件的流程
在Python中,我们可以使用pandas库来读取和处理SAS文件。下面是读取SAS文件的整个流程:
| 步骤 | 描述 |
| ---- | ---- |
| 1. | 导入所需的库 |
| 2. | 指定SAS文件的路径 |
| 3. | 读取SAS文件并转换为DataFrame格式 |
| 4. | 对DataFrame进行进一步处
原创
2023-07-22 17:25:25
1008阅读
导语:笔者通过在Stack Overflow分析用户创建的开发者履历,得出了最不受开发者欢迎的编程语言,还有最受开发者欢迎的技术,以及软件生态圈的竞争关系。文/ David Robinson译/ 欧剃如果你用 Stack Overflow的话(推荐大家都去用下),在职业生涯页面上,用户可以创建自己的开发者履历,展示自己获得到成就,推动职业生涯的进展。在充实履历的过程中,有一个选项,可以让用户添加自
# SAS与Python的比较与应用
在数据分析和统计建模的领域中,SAS(Statistical Analysis System)和Python无疑是两种非常流行的工具。尽管它们的应用场景和工作方式有所不同,但二者各有千秋,适用于不同的数据处理需求。本文将探讨SAS与Python的基本概念、优缺点以及代码示例,帮助您更好地理解这两种工具的使用。
## 一、SAS的基础
SAS是一种商业统计
# 使用SAS进行数据分析:新手指南
数据分析是现代数据科学中的一项重要技能,而 SAS(Statistical Analysis System)被广泛应用于数据管理和分析。针对刚入行的小白,本文将一步步介绍如何使用 SAS 进行数据分析,并提供相应的代码示例、注释和流程图。
## 数据分析流程概览
首先,让我们看一下进行数据分析的基本流程:
| 步骤 | 描述